HC Deb 28 January 1966 vol 723 c144W
Mr. Hector Hughes

asked the Secretary of State for Scotland if he will make a detailed statement on the progress of the Scottish Economic Planning Council, set up by him, who are considering the forthcoming White Paper on the Scottish Economy; and if he will take steps to obviate the undue emphasis on the South-West and Midlands of Scotland and the neglect of eastern Scotland, thereby increasing the drift of skilled workers to the South-West and Midlands of Scotland and to England.

Mr. Ross

The White Paper on the Scottish Economy published on 26th January gives a detailed account of the work of the Scottish Economic Planning Council on this subject. It sets out a programme which will enable all parts of the country, including the North-East, to play a full part in an expanding economy. A substantial reduction in outward migration is one of the most important objectives of this programme.
